How to terraform well in Minecraft 1.14?

Hi guys;
I have a problem since some years but I reached a point where I do not want to ignore it much longer.
I have a server world and on this world a have a city very close to some ex-binom borders. Before the 1.13 Update I started to terraform that area with mcedit and changed the tundra to a desert by changing the binom to desert and the grass to sand. Than I stopped and a few day later the update was out - the terraforming was not finsihed but mcedit was not able to work anymore. First I stopped my plans to build there until I would have a working mcedit version. After I found out there will not be such a McEdit version I started to learn to work with structure blocks and some ingame coments and terraformed the land by hand; removing the forrest needed weekes.....

Now I built the city; but the new problem; from the harbour you could see terrain generated with th 1.13 version; or 1.14 not sure. Anyways it looks like s***. Now I would really like to expand on the sea to creat here some ships, a ligthhouse, maybe a little coast castle or tower but for this i need to remove the 'wrong land' and terraform it to sea. But there is not McEdit, WorldPainter cannot import this world because of an unexpected error and doing this by hand is not really an option, because it is to much.

So I want to know if anyone has a good idea what I could do now to make this for good. I would be happy if anyone has any good ideas or tools.
Important this is a vanillia server so do not start with mods like WorldEdit - that doesn't help me.

Import world file into a spigot server for the sole purpose of terraforming and use world edit, then once the work is done unload it from your spigot server and reload it as vanilla

Are you 100% sure that his works without getting problems after? I heard a lot about problems if you want to get a bukkit server world back to a vanilla - and it seems so that even the spigot need a bukkit plugin for this, because the World Edit plugin is for a bukkit server

I will be honest, I dont know 100% for sure but I can tell you that I'm 90% sure it should be fine, infact there is a way to do this WITHOUT damaging your world save file.

so what I would recommend then would be to make a COPY of your world save file. load it onto a spigot server. install Worldedit plugin. get the work you need done finished then TEST to see if you can reinstall that world file as vanilla.

If it works out fine then there ya go

If it doesn't work out then no problem because you edited a COPY not the original

Another important thing I should mention, if you want to maintain the integrity of any command blocks on your server make sure you ENABLE command blocks via Server.Properties when you go to port your world save into spigot for terraforming.
